Feral horses increase in Kosciuszko National Park





Environment advocates say the NSW government is failing to meet its promise to control feral horses in the Kosciuszko National Park. Based on surveys conducted in November, the government estimates numbers have grown to 18,814, up from 14,380 in 2020.
